Output c19266f52681580bb6bc6fa2965d3c6048b433efff87157d88362a955ef4f633:3

value
417287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c86c1289d2590cb33d9d9631d460927d87e4bf OP_EQUAL
address
3HScF7aaZvK9JbMVYbr7jqTzAeeQ1rkR3B
transaction
c19266f52681580bb6bc6fa2965d3c6048b433efff87157d88362a955ef4f633
confirmations
219083
spent
true